Training and Professional Development

AkindaCo offers a range of training courses and professional development programs, both online and in-person. We specialise in providing educational offerings that focus on working with young people, families, individuals and organisations, with a focus on systemic thinking, expressive modalities, attachment, trauma-informed practice and neurobiology (including polyvagal theory).

The Introduction to Expressive Therapy course breaks down the basics of Expressive Therapy. This course is ideal for professionals who are interested in implementing Expressive Therapy concepts into their practice.  
 

Topics covered include the intersection of Expressive Therapy and attachment, trauma, neurobiology and child development. 

We will discuss case studies and cultural and ethical considerations. Importantly, we understand Expressive Therapy to be an experiential, body-based approach, and that the lived experience of participating in activities gives rich insight into the effective and therapeutic elements of Expressive Therapy. 
 

Be prepared to create, hold space for your own and others’ vulnerability, curiosity and growth, and to invoke a genuine in-the-moment learning process; all guided by highly experienced and qualified psychotherapists from AkindaCo.

Introduction to Systemic Family Therapy

New dates announced soon!

This 2-day training breaks down the basics of Systemic Family Therapy. This course is ideal for professionals who are interested in implementing systemic understandings and practices into their work.

Topics covered include the history of family therapy and systemic practice, philosophical understandings underpinning systemic practice, the diverse ways of working with families and individuals with a systemic lens and techniques utilised by family therapists. We will discuss case studies and cultural and ethical implications.

Art Therapy 5-Day Foundation Course

New dates announced soon!

This 5 day experiential course is intended for professionals interested in the expressive and therapeutic use of art, and focuses on:

• What art therapy is

• Theory and history

• Specific approaches and applications of art therapy

• Art therapy with individuals

• Group art therapy

• Differences between art and art therapy

• Art therapy with children and young people

• Practical application of art therapy

• International developments in art therapy practice
 

The main body of the course will take the form of experiential workshops, practical demonstrations, lectures, seminars, examples of case studies, pair and group work and a short project completed between workshops.

Therapeutic Use of Genograms

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

New dates announced soon!

In this training, you will be guided to use Genograms in assessment and intervention with individuals, couples, children and families. Our trainers will guide you through the history and fundamental tenets of using Genograms. This course will also highlight how to engage children in the Genogram process, how to manage high affect or reactivity relating to the Genogram, how to incorporate creative modalities with the Genogram and ethical considerations including cultural safety, working with LGBTQIA+ clients or children in residential care.
